Output edafab6fa69dce90ed92911afebac58f341dcc88417239d8a15acbd1d3af5b58: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edf1be030fac4bda590312d44b233cc2c62345ef OP_EQUAL
address
AE8QQQ4dC2brtorHyFdnypqqzNhCJyFUt3
transaction
edafab6fa69dce90ed92911afebac58f341dcc88417239d8a15acbd1d3af5b58